Tryptophan is an over-the-counter antidepressant that can also be used by pregnant women. Not only is melatonin synthesized from tryptophan, but, importantly, serotonin is also synthesized from it. This dietary supplement should significantly increase serotonin levels, which is the neurotransmitter of happiness. Unfortunately, the effect may not be that strong because there is also a mechanism for serotonin reuptake in the CNS.

Since phenylalanine is a precursor of dopamine, phenylalanine is also an antidepressant. There are several antidepressant drugs based on dopamine as the principle of their functioning.
